15 <br /> <br />Each vote shall be decided by a majority of the valid ballots cast (a majority is determined by <br />dividing the number of valid ballots cast by two and taking the next highest whole number). It is <br />the duty of each member to vote for as many appointees as there are appointments to be made, but <br />failure to do so does not invalidate that member's ballot. <br /> <br />Rule 33. Reference to Robert's Rules of Order. <br /> <br />To the extent not provided for in, and not conflicting with the spirit of, these rules, the chair shall <br />refer to RRO to resolve procedural questions. <br /> <br />Comment: RRO was designed to govern a large legislative assembly, and many of its provisions may <br />be inappropriate for small boards. Nevertheless, it is the best source of parliamentary procedure; care <br />should simply be taken to adjust RRO to meet the needs of small governing boards. <br /> <br /> <br />
